
The differences between 98 and 95 gasoline are as follows: The octane number is different: the higher the gasoline grade, the higher the octane number, and the higher the octane number, the better the stability of the gasoline. Suitable for different models: 98 gasoline is suitable for high-end luxury cars and high-horsepower sports cars, while 95 gasoline is suitable for the vast majority of cars. Information about gasoline is as follows: Gasoline: It appears as a transparent liquid, is flammable, with a distillation range of 30°C to 220°C. The main components are C5~C12 aliphatic hydrocarbons and cycloalkanes, as well as a certain amount of aromatic hydrocarbons. Gasoline has a high octane number (anti-knock combustion performance). Classification: According to the octane number, it is divided into grades such as 90, 93, 95, 97, etc.
